Controlling Focus After Recording (Post Focus)
Applicable modes:
The camera allows you to take 4K burst pictures while shifting the focus to different
areas. After taking these pictures, you can select the desired focus area.
This function is suited for recording still objects.
• Use a UHS Speed Class 3 card.
• The angle of view may become narrower during recording.
1
Press [ ].
2
Press 2/1 to select [ON] and press
[MENU/SET].
3
Decide on the composition, and
press the shutter button halfway.
• Auto Focus will detect focus areas on the
screen. (Excluding the edges of the screen)
• If no areas on the screen can be brought into
focus, the focus display (
A
) will flash.
Recording is not possible in this case.
4
Press the shutter button fully to start
recording.
• The focus point changes automatically while
recording. When the icon (
B
) disappears,
recording automatically ends.
• A motion picture in MP4 format will be recorded. (Audio will not be recorded.)
• When [Auto Review] is enabled, a screen that lets you select the desired focus
area will be displayed. (P37)
∫ Cancelling [Post Focus]
Select [OFF] in step
2.
From the time you press the shutter button halfway until the end of recording:
• Maintain the same distance to the subject and the same composition.
